Holder admits to wounding man

Roger Holder will return to the District ‘A’ Magistrates’ Court next Tuesday after confessing to a wounding charge.

Appearing before Magistrate Manila Renee, the 55-year-old of Buckingham Road, Bank Hall, St Michael, was granted $1 500 bail with one surety after admitting to unlawfully and maliciously wounding Wendell Smith on December 12.

The magistrate adjourned the matter until January 23, when the complainant is expected to appear.
